More on the Philips Fidelio L3 ANC Wireless Headphones:

Fidelio L3 combines precise audio engineering and leading edge tech to deliver superior sound quality. 40mm drivers make for natural, perfectly balanced notes—tight bass, smooth, rounded midrange and high frequencies that sparkle with detail. Two mics in each ear cup filter out unwanted sounds, leaving you free to immerse. Awareness mode is there to bring the outside world back to you when needed.
